Will you be serving lunch on Christmas Day?
Address: 120 N Court St, Florence, AL 35630, USA
dj lallier | Jun 26, 2019
Great menu not sure about holiday hrs.
Scott Bales | Jun 26, 2019
Would be amazing if they are, but I doubt it
David Hammer | Jun 26, 2019
doubtful
Thanks! Your answer is awaiting moderation.